Growing up is not easy, and sometimes it's hard to cope with whatever life throws at you.  The good news is there are lots of things that CAMHS might be able to help you with, such as: 

  • Feeling anxious, worried or scared 
  • Feeling sad 
  • Hurting yourself or wanting to hurt yourself 
  • Feeling like you don't want to be alive any more  
  • Feeling like you have to check or repeat things, or having a sense that you are responsible for stopping bad things from happening
  • Having problems with eating and food 
  • Feeling distressed and overwhelmed by upsetting events (trauma) 
  • Hearing voices or seeing things. 

For more information about the above problems, see our common conditions and difficulties section on the jargon buster page. CAMHS may also be able to help you with some of the issues that can be related to the above problems e.g.:  

  • Your relationships with others such as your family  
  • Your sleep 
  • Your concentration 
  • Your education.
